Submitted by Sjef Verbeek (LUMC, Leiden, Netherlands, The) 12/16/2009 Specfic AONs interfering with the splicing machinery can induce exon skipping resulting in truncated mRNA. This technology can be used to generate specific (truncated ) proteins both for fundamental research and for treatment of particular diseases (e.g. muscle dystrophy). Macrophages might be one of the major cell types which take up these AONs when administrated systemically. Therefore targeting efficiency of these AONs will be analysed in the absence and presence of macrophages.
- RESPONSE TO ERYTHROID STRESS IN MICE TREATED WITH LIP-CLOD.
Submitted by Thalia Papayannopoulou (University of Washington, Seattle, WA, United States) 12/15/2009 Macrophages in hematopoietic tissues have been considered as an erythroid niche for the development of the final stages of erythroid cell maturation. Using normal animals treated with Lip-Clod, we wish to assess to what extent the erythroid response to RBC hemolytic agent (APH) is compromised after a single injection of Lip-Clod. Documentation of macrophage ablation in spleen will be done by histochemical or immunological assessment of F480+ cells in spleen post Lip-Clod treatment. Erythroid populations will be assessed at the progenitor level and at distinct stages of differentiation.

- The effect of macrophage depletion on the development of hypertension in SHR rats
Submitted by Christoph Schmaderer (Klinikum rechts der Isar der technischen Universität München, München, Germany) 12/10/2009 The main focus of our project is to determine the role of macrophages in the development of hypertension. Therefore we aim to deplete macrophages in SHR rats to see the development of hypertentension in these. We hypothesize an amelioration of blood pressure in macrophage depleted animals as perivascular inflammation triggered by macrophages is seen in histological sections.

- Role of macrophage in ovarian cancer metastasis
Submitted by Ho Hyung Woo (Arizona Cancer Center, Tucson, United States) 4/12/2009 We are studying molecular aspects of ovarian cancer metastasis. Our study indicates M-CSF-1 is one of the causing factors in ovarian cancer metastasis. Since M-CSF-1 is expressed highly in macrophage, macrophage suicide by clodronate liposome can give a tool to understand the role of macrophage in ovarian cancer metastasis. Down regulation of macrophage may either prevent or activate ovarian cancer metastasis. In macrophage depleted-mouse model, ovarian cancer cells will be injected and monitor tumor development.
